The invention discloses an
underwater explosive ordnance disposal control method and
system based on an AI
large model and a
robot, and relates to the technical field of
underwater robotics.
Underwater optical images and
sonar data are collected through a sensing module and input into a pre-trained AI
large model for real-time analysis, potential threats are recognized, and a decision instruction containing a path planning and operation sequence is generated; when the analysis confidence coefficient is lower than a threshold
value set based on historical data, interaction information containing multi-
modal data abstracts, alternative schemes and
risk assessment is automatically generated and sent to an operator, instructions are executed after being received, the
system comprises a sensing module, an AI
processing module, a communication module, a control execution module and a state monitoring module, and a
robot body is integrated with a processor to solidify the method. The autonomous decision-making precision and efficiency of the
robot in a complex environment are improved through an AI
large model, the man-
machine cooperation response speed is optimized by using an intelligent interaction mechanism, and the reliability and environmental adaptability of the
system are significantly enhanced in combination with state monitoring and edge-cloud cooperative computing.
